🌤️ Best Time to Visit

Best visited in summer (June-August) for grassland scenery. Fall offers golden colors. Winters are extremely cold. Pack layers even in summer as temperatures vary greatly between day and night.

June July August September
Summer: 20°C (68°F)
Winter: -25°C (-13°F)

🎎 Cultural Tips (15 tips)

Essential cultural knowledge for Hulunbuir

Mongolian Hospitality

High Priority

Mongolians greet guests with hada (ceremonial silk scarf) and offer milk tea. Accepting hospitality shows respect. Refusing food or drink can offend hosts.

Yurt Culture

High Priority

The yurt (ger) is traditional Mongolian home. The north side is the most honored position. Never step on the threshold or point feet at the central fire.

Mongolian Diet

High Priority

Mongolian cuisine centers on lamb, beef, dairy, and grains. Hand-grabbed lamb and milk tea are staples. Traditional dishes reflect nomadic lifestyle and harsh climate.

Toasting Etiquette

Medium Priority

When offered milk tea, receive with both hands. It's polite to drink at least a little. Snuff (powdered tobacco) may be offered instead - decline politely if not desired.

Horse Culture

Medium Priority

Horses are central to Mongolian identity. Never hit or abuse horses. When riding, follow local guide's instructions. Horse shows demonstrate traditional equestrian skills.

Shamanism and Buddhism

Medium Priority

Mongolians practice a blend of shamanism and Tibetan Buddhism. Prayer flags, shamanic ceremonies, and Buddhist shrines coexist. Show respect at religious sites.

Grassland Protection

High Priority

The grassland ecosystem is fragile. Stay on designated paths, don't disturb wildlife, and minimize plastic use. Support sustainable tourism practices.

Nadam Festival

Medium Priority

The traditional Mongolian 'Three Manly Games' - wrestling, horse racing, and archery - are showcased at Nadam festivals held during summer months.

Dairy Products

Medium Priority

Mongolians produce various dairy: milk, yogurt, cheese, air-dried curd (hurung), and mare's milk (airag). These are important nutritional sources and cultural items.

Traditional Dress

Low Priority

The Mongolian deel is traditional clothing worn for festivals. Modern Mongolians wear it on special occasions. Visitors welcome to try deel for photos.
